Async traffic issue, need suggestions
IPs have been changed from what we are really using.
These are Virprion 2400s runing BIG-IP 10.2.4 Build 595.0 Hotfix HF3 in a Active/standby cluster
Client on 10.64.69.126/26 is trying to access a pool of servers on the same subnet 10.64.69.95 - 98. Their Virtual server IP is 10.64.69.39/26 it is HTTP port 80 all the way through using SNAT automap on the VS.
What I have seen is that when it fails it appears as though the initial SYN packet gets to the client and the client sends a SYN/ACK back to the F5 but the captures on the F5 do not record it ever seeing this packet, this could be an asyncronous path issue and is not my real question.
In this Scenario the client machine is using a default Gateway of our core, but if I change it to the F5 I am unable to connect to the virtual server at all. I asked f5 about this and the engineer I am working with said that made sense to him since we are using route domains, but I find that strange.
Why can't I use the F5 as my gateway to hit a Virtual server that is on that same f5 in the same route domain I am in? I had assumed I made a configuration mistake, but now I am wondering if this just is not possible.
I do plan to continue talks with F5, but I was hoping someone on her emight have some advice besides that.
